Where to Go

There are a number of things to see and do in Fort Scott, including:

  • The Fort Scott National Historic Site: This site is home to the remains of Fort Scott, a US Army fort that was built in 1842.
  • The Lowell Milken Center for Unsung Heroes: This museum tells the stories of unsung heroes from around the world.
  • The Fort Scott Farmers Market: This market is held every Saturday from May to October and features a variety of local produce, crafts, and food.
